3 つの行列を組み合わせた YouTube のチュートリアルに従っていますprojectionMatrix * viewMatrix * transformationMatrix
。これらにより、シーンを制御するカメラとともに 3D キューブをレンダリングできます。私の質問は、キューブがカメラの動きによって中心からずれている場合、
これらのマトリックス/マトリックスは下のキューブの側面をどのように表示するのですか?
カメラが左にパンした
カメラが X 軸上を移動するとき、立方体の左側を表示するのはどの行列ですか? 頂点が (z 軸上で) 離れているほど、動きの影響が少なくなるため、前の頂点が移動して後ろの頂点が明らかになるためでしょうか。以下のように?
射影行列は、立方体の側面が遠くの頂点で小さくなることに関係している可能性があることを理解しています。また、フロントクワッドは歪んでいないのでキューブが回転しているとは思えません。私の理論は、変換行列が頂点をさらに遅れさせているため、明らかにされているということです。